Ticket #DIFF-level — Sign-off needed: big-file diff viewer

Hey reviewers — the new chunked rendering for Spanview's diff viewer is ready. Files over 50MB now stream in pages instead of freezing the tab, and syntax highlighting degrades gracefully past 10k lines. I've tested against our gnarliest generated files and it holds up. Before we merge, this needs a formal sign-off per the review policy. The sign-off has to come from the component owner, named below.

named custodian: Belius Casath Ulaix Sorius

Subject: Quickstore 4.2 — bloom filter now fronts the KV layer

Plugin authors: starting with this release, Quickstore places a bloom filter ahead of the key-value store. Negative lookups return faster; false positives fall through safely. No API changes are required on your side. Verify your plugin against the staging build referenced below.

session token of fahif-tadup = htk3_9c7

### Step 4: Migrate the Password Reset Tables

The revamped reset flow in Thornvale replaces single-use email tokens with short-lived codes stored server-side. New team members should note the old `reset_tokens` table stays read-only for thirty days for audit purposes, then gets dropped. Run the migration script once per environment and verify row counts match the report. The script targets the auth database via the connection string below.

primary connection of tajeg-tajop = postgresql://julax_svc:DI@db-e7f3.kelvidyn.corp:5432/rusdor